CLOUD.OLCLOUD.OLOSL
Loading
EBITDA Over TimeContracting
Percentile Rank71
3Y CAGR+59.5%
Studio
Year-over-Year Change

Earnings before interest, taxes, depreciation, and amortization

3Y CAGR
+59.5%/yr
Annual compound
Percentile
P71
Within normal range
vs 3Y Ago
4.1x
Strong expansion
Streak
2 yr
Consecutive declineContracting
PeriodValueYoY Change
2025$211.00M-37.4%
2024$337.00M-17.2%
2023$407.00M+682.7%
2022$52.00M+205.6%
2021$-49.25M-85.4%
2020$-26.57M-919.4%
2019$-2.61M-48.6%
2018$-1.75M-